What companies run services between Santo Ângelo, Brazil and Beto Carrero World, Brazil?

Azul flies from Sepé Tiaraju Airport (GEL) to Navegantes–Ministro Victor Konder International Airport (NVT) 4 times a week. Alternatively, Penha operates a bus from Rodoviária de Santo Ângelo to Terminal Rodoviário de Balneário Camboriú once a week. Tickets cost R$150–500 and the journey takes 14h 24m. Viação Ouro e Prata also services this route once a week.
